The Cosby Show (1984)
TRAILER

The Cosby Show (1984)

Description: A groundbreaking sitcom that portrays an upper-middle-class African American family, focusing on parenting, relationships, and the importance of education and values.

Fact: The show was one of the first to depict a successful African American family in a positive light, breaking stereotypes on television.

The Fresh Prince of Bel-Air (1990)
TRAILER

The Fresh Prince of Bel-Air (1990)

Description: A family sitcom that blends humor with heartfelt moments, focusing on the dynamics of a blended family and the cultural adjustments of a young man moving to a new environment.

Fact: The show was inspired by the real-life experiences of its star, Will Smith, and his transition from West Philadelphia to a more affluent lifestyle.

Martin (1992)
TRAILER

Martin (1992)

Description: A sitcom centered around the life of a charismatic radio DJ, blending slapstick humor with romantic and familial relationships.

Fact: Martin Lawrence played multiple characters on the show, including the iconic Mama Payne.

The Jamie Foxx Show (1996)
TRAILER

The Jamie Foxx Show (1996)

Description: A sitcom about a struggling musician who works at his family's hotel, blending workplace humor with personal and romantic storylines.

Fact: Jamie Foxx co-created the show and also wrote and performed the theme song.

Moesha (1996)
TRAILER

Moesha (1996)

Description: A coming-of-age sitcom that explores the life of a teenage girl balancing school, family, and friendships, with a mix of humor and drama.

Fact: The show was Brandy Norwood's first major acting role, and it helped launch her career beyond music.

Girlfriends (2000)
TRAILER

Girlfriends (2000)

Description: A dramedy that follows the lives of four African American women as they deal with career challenges, romantic relationships, and personal growth.

Fact: The show was one of the longest-running sitcoms centered around Black women, lasting for eight seasons.

Everybody Hates Chris (2005)
TRAILER

Everybody Hates Chris (2005)

Description: A comedic take on the challenges of growing up in a working-class family, with a strong emphasis on family bonds and the humorous struggles of adolescence.

Fact: The series is loosely based on the childhood experiences of comedian Chris Rock, who also narrates the show.
